Is St Petersburg College a 4 year college?

History. St. Petersburg College (SPC), founded in 1927, is Florida's first two-year college. Regionally accredited and nationally recognized, SPC was the first community college in Florida to offer bachelor's degrees.

What is the history of Florida?

This course outlines chronologically the economic, social, geographic and political background of Florida from the time of discovery through settlement, colonization and statehood. Florida's role in the Civil War and Reconstruction Period is reviewed and the state's agricultural development into the 20th century is described. Current issues including the impact of urbanization, tourism, and industrialization are emphasized.

What is the last course in English as a second language?

As the last course in English as a Second Language, this component is designed to increase and refine skills in reading speed, comprehension and retention; in writing organization, fluency, clarity and style; and in understanding and applying advanced grammatical concepts to enhance both comprehension and expression in English. Group interaction, critical thinking skills and appreciation of cultural differences in learning approaches are incorporated in instructional techniques. (Note: A total of 12 credits from EAP 1695 and EAP 1500 can be used for graduation credit. Credit is only given for EAP 1685 or EAP 1686 or EAP 1695 .) Prerequisite: EAP 1595 or an appropriate score on the standardized placement test for ESL.

What is the ASL class?

This course is a continuation of Intermediate American Sign Language (ASL) designed to develop expressive and receptive signing skills to an advanced level. Included are compound/complex sentences, inflectional signs, tense and time, sign modulations, and classifiers. Discussion may also include cultural issues and optional professional careers in deafness. Prerequisite: ( ENC 0025 or ENC 0027 or ENC 0056 with a minimum grade of C) and ( REA 0017 or REA 0056 with a minimum grade of C) or EAP 1695 with a minimum grade of C or Appropriate score on the college placement test. and ( ASL 1150C and Pre or Corequisite: ASL 1510 with a minimum grade of C)

What is the HSA BAS course?

This course explores a broad range of abnormalities in the physiologic functioning of the human cardiopulmonary system. Additional topics include the etiology, pathogenesis, and clinical manifestations of related systems to include the digestive, renal, nervous and endocrine systems. Course content prepares the credentialed Respiratory Therapist to distinguish between health and non-health of related systems Admission to: HSA-BAS with a minimum grade of C and Prerequisite: ( HSA 3104 or HSA 4184 with a minimum grade of C) Or Permission of the Program: Respiratory Care
